→ Russia visa for Montenegrin citizens
Montenegro passport holders can enjoy visa-free travel to Russia for up to 30 days, a privilege that makes exploring iconic destinations like Moscow and St. Petersburg remarkably straightforward. This seamless entry, facilitated by the current visa-free status, is perfect for experiencing Russian culture within your allotted stay, and while the primary visa type for tourism is a single entry, the absence of a visa fee for this duration significantly reduces pre-travel expenses.
